Output e24af425befac719dcdb83b91557b70561a34dff56ca92718dcb0ffe01653b79:1

value
2797500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 038459aee73c5d624281f40e2fc81bc0a686d0e4 OP_EQUAL
address
321cVyrVF7eigNbsuepbmSRsaY9tUkFqxo
transaction
e24af425befac719dcdb83b91557b70561a34dff56ca92718dcb0ffe01653b79
confirmations
270302
spent
true